Deicing Fluid
Ground deicing of aircraft is commonly performed in both commercial and general aviation. The fluids used in this operation are called deicing or anti-icing fluids. The initials ADF (Aircraft Deicing Fluid), ADAF (Aircraft Deicer and Anti-icer Fluid) or AAF (Aircraft Anti-icing Fluid) are commonly used.

Permian–Triassic Extinction Event
The Permian–Triassic extinction event, also known as the P–Tr extinction, the P–T extinction, the End-Permian Extinction, and colloquially as the Great Dying, formed the boundary between the Permian and Triassic geologic periods, as well as between the Paleozoic and Mesozoic eras, approximately 252 million years ago. It is the Earth's most severe known extinction event, with up to 96% of all marine species and 70% of terrestrial vertebrate species becoming extinct. It was the largest known mass extinction of insects. Some 57% of all biological families and 83% of all genera became extinct. There is evidence for one to three distinct pulses, or phases, of extinction. Potential causes for those pulses include one or more large meteor impact events, massive volcanic eruptions (such as the Siberian Traps), and climate change brought on by large releases of underwater methane or methane-producing microbes. The speed of the recovery from the extinction is disputed. Some scientists estimate that it took 10 million years (until the Middle Triassic), due both to the severity of the extinction and because grim conditions returned periodically for another 5 million years. However, studies in Bear Lake County, near Paris, Idaho, showed a relatively quick rebound in a localized Early Triassic marine ecosystem, taking around 2 million years to recover, suggesting that the impact of the extinction may have been felt less severely in some areas than others.

Adaptability Quotient
Adaptability Quotient (AQ) is a metric of adaptability used to measure performance in the workplace and assess individual potential. The earliest article published by Stuart Parkin in 2010 gave rise to the term Adaptability Quotient. This has inspired many others to expand and research the area. A recent deep dive into Adaptability Quotient can be found at SingularityU London Adaptability Webinar: "Developing adaptable workforces, a roadmap to recovery", where Ross Thornley, is joined by Jason Slater from UNIDO and Professor Nicolas Deuschel . Additionally Amin Toufani in 2014, shares his insights during his public lecture at Singularity University. he defines AQ as the ability to realize optimal outcomes based on recent or future change. Ross Thornley and Mike Raven's work at AQai is deepening the scientific research of AQ in the workplace, opening up new frontiers of understanding and links across multiple disciplines. Their A.C.E model is widely seen as the most holistic and comprehensive assessment. AQ is defined as, "Measuring the abilities, characteristics, and environmental factors which impact the successful behaviors and actions of people, and organizations to effectively respond to uncertainty, new information, or changed circumstances.” Decoding AQ 2020, Ross Thornley. (As of 2019), there is a growing body of literature surrounding adaptability, and consequent interest in being able to harness, measure, and quantify adaptability in the workplace. Adaptability was identified as the “new competitive advantage” by the Harvard Business Review in 2011. In 2014, The Flux Report (published by Right Management in the UK) revealed that 91% of HR managers thought that: "People will be recruited on their ability to deal with change and uncertainty" as opposed to other skills. Specifically adaptive performance in the research literature means numerous organizational scholars have recognized that traditional models of performance are static and need to be augmented to include "responsiveness to changing job requirements" — labeled adaptive performance (AP; Allworth & Hesketh, 1999, p. 98; Griffin, Neal, & Parker, 2007; Pulakos, Arad, Donovan, & Plamondon, 2000).

Birth Certificate
A birth certificate is a vital record that documents the birth of a child. The term "birth certificate" can refer to either the original document certifying the circumstances of the birth or to a certified copy of or representation of the ensuing registration of that birth. Depending on the jurisdiction, a record of birth might or might not contain verification of the event by such as a midwife or doctor.

Challenges to Renewable Energy Transition in China
Climate change and energy issues have become the prominent global challenge and a major concern of China. China’s energy sector, which heavily relies on fossil energy, especially coal, is the largest contributor to China’s carbon emissions. According to the International Energy Agency (IEA), China’s energy consumption accounts for nearly 90% of China’s total CO2 emissions in 2020. The carbon neutrality target poses a huge challenge to China’s energy system, causing energy transition to be the key to the overall decarbonization of China’s economy and society.
